Chapter 17 The Night's Watch
Chapter 17 The Night's Watch
Lewis's head was about to explode with fear, and he heard endless whispers in his ears. They belonged to Amon, and were a suppression from his status. He took a step back and hurriedly pulled out a gun from his gun bag and pointed it at Amon.
"I look forward to you coming to me." Amon looked at the sky and smiled calmly. He opened his mouth and slowly uttered a sentence: "You and I are always under the watchful eyes of the night."
As Amon's voice fell, his body disappeared piece by piece as if being erased by an eraser. At the end of the alley, there seemed to be a young lady in nun's clothes smiling at him, but it was only a momentary illusion.
Lewis came back to his senses, he nodded four times on his chest, and said solemnly: “…Night is above, praise you, goddess.”
At this moment, his faith in the goddess had never been so devout.
As the battle ended, Lewis heard the footsteps of pedestrians again, and the surrounding environment became chaotic, indicating that the things stolen by Amon had returned.
Lewis went back to the spot and picked up the black top hat. He suppressed his inner joy and pretended to be nonchalant as he walked back home.
Now that the things stolen by Amon have returned, it is time for Mandy, who has disappeared for a long time, to go home. Influenced by the original owner of the body, Lewis felt the long-lost excitement.
I really want to drink a bowl of tomato beef soup cooked by Mandy, then eat a sandwich filled with chicken, and fall asleep to Mandy's gentle voice.
Of course, this has a prerequisite, that is, he must meet the real Mandy, not the impostor pretended by Amon.
Pushing open the door to the Night Vanilla block again, the feeling of danger had disappeared. Lewis went back to the room and looked, but Mandy was not there.
"Let's go out and look for it."
After sitting in the empty room for a while, Lewis began to get impatient and went to the bank where Mandy used to work according to his memory.
Unfortunately, it was almost completely dark at this time and even the banks were closed.
"Hello, is Ms. Mandy Harvey home yet?" Lewis met a slightly plump gentleman. He knew that this was Mandy's colleague Faulkner Ben, and he had a good relationship with Mandy.
"Mandy Harvey?" Faulkner touched his hairless head and said in embarrassment, "Sir, I don't think I know Mandy Harvey. Who are you?"
Lewis froze in place, the hairs on his back stood up one by one, and he felt an indescribable malice.
“Sorry, I recognized the wrong person.” Lewis lowered his head and turned away.
"What a weird person, Mandy Harvey?" Faulkner got on the carriage on the side of the road, and the carriage started running, making a series of familiar sounds.
Lewis wandered aimlessly in the streets, not knowing what went wrong, but thought of what Amon said before he disappeared.
"Looking forward to seeing you next time? Is that what you mean?"
Lewis laughed at himself. Although he didn't know what Amon was thinking, he would never go looking for Amon. With his own strength, he could also find Mandy.
After returning home, Lewis went to Mandy's room, found the necklace that Mandy often wore, and entered a trance state.
"Mandy Harvey is still alive..."
After reciting it three times, Lewis saw the necklace rotate clockwise, and then swayed. The divination was disturbed again, or the preconditions were insufficient and the divination could not be performed.
"Mandy Harvey's location."
After writing down the divination statement, Lewis held the necklace in his hand and then lay down on Mandy's bed. He wanted to use dream divination.
Closing his eyes, Lewis gradually entered a state of emptiness.
Passing through the white light in front of him, Lewis arrived at an extremely dark place. There was no sun or moon in the sky. Only the lightning across the sky could bring bursts of light, allowing him to see the situation clearly.
"The God-Forsaken Land!" Lewis subconsciously shouted out his guess. If Amon hid Mandy in the God-Forsaken Land, then the pendulum divination method would indeed be disturbed, because the evil god, the real creator, was sleeping in the God-Forsaken Land.
Walking around, Lewis began to look around, holding on to the only glimmer of hope left, hoping that Mandy was still alive and healthy, and had not turned into a monster or been contaminated.
The lightning subsided and Lewis was plunged into complete darkness, but then a light flashed before his eyes and Mandy appeared in sight in a white dress.
“Sister!” Lewis walked forward, his face slightly flushed with excitement. This was a good dream.
"We meet again, my dear brother." Mandy took out a monocle from somewhere, put it on his right eye and squeezed it.
Lewis twitched his lips, and the beautiful dream instantly turned into a nightmare. His dream divination pointed to Amon. Fortunately, he had already guessed that there might be something wrong with the divination, so he did not show panic.
"Where on earth did you take Mandy? Blasphemer, Amon." Lewis suppressed his anger and asked.
"I stole Mandy Harvey's destiny. So, no matter what method you use to look for it, it will eventually lead to me." Amon conjured up a square table and several benches. Several clones gradually solidified their figures. While shouting one, two, three, they began to busily boil water and prepare tableware.
Soon, steaming coffee was placed on the square table. Mandy put three sugar cubes into the black tea and stirred it with a spoon.
"I think you should listen to my conditions." Mandy took a sip of coffee, put the coffee cup down, and said slowly: "When you choose a certain path, your friends and enemies are destined."
"You are the destiny path, and I am the error path. We are not enemies, we can even be friends, Lewis." Mandy explained: "Maybe you can't see your destiny clearly yet, but as long as you become my dependent, I will return Mandy to you and can also help you solve some 'small problems'."
"Become your dependent?" Lewis couldn't help but think of Klein's experience and sneered, "I will bear the price of fate, and you will inherit the dividends, right?"
"You are more knowledgeable than I thought, and you know more." Mandy couldn't help but applaud and said with emotion: "That is indeed my usual approach, but you are different. Not only will I not steal your destiny, I will also help you become a god."
“I’m sorry, I can’t agree to your request.” Lewis didn’t believe Amon at all. He had no desire to continue the conversation. After exiting the dream, he opened his eyes, looked at the cedar ceiling, and sighed.
It might be difficult for him to find Mandy using divination, so he had to think of other ways.
At present, it seems that if there is a true god willing to help him deal with Amon, he will find Mandy soon. But it is obvious that he cannot afford the price that the true god needs to pay.
Or maybe he would make good use of the method of acting and work hard to digest the potion until one day, he would become a god.
(End of this chapter)
